Don`t Know why Mazda bother fitting this tyre for the uk market, come winter time here with the snow & ice the car feels like Bambi on ice. I know that this a summer tyre test but i would at least prefer a tyre that gives some grip in the winter months. Would I buy this tyre again definately not-life is already to short as it is!
